I got myself some Deda Superzero carbon bars to replace my Superzero alloy bars. I (tried) to mount them to my Deda Superzero stem, but they were simply too large and deformed quite a lot (and creaked a lot!).
I followed the assembly instructions and used a torque wrench. I’ve installed carbon bars twice before (FSA and Canyon) and never had an issue.
The creaking noise happened at only 3Nm (Deda specs 4Nm) – and the bars were clearly deformed at only 2Nm.
I called Sigma Sports and they asked me to send the bars back for warranty. Anyone else had any issues with Deda bars being oversize at the clamp?
